Exploring the Media & Entertainment Landscape with a Market Research Agency in Abu Dhabi
Three forces set Abu Dhabi apart. First, a production-first ecosystem: through twofour54 and the Creative Media Authority, the emirate has assembled studios, talent pipelines, and generous rebates in one place, so content here is made as well as consumed. Second, a serious gaming and esports agenda under the AD Gaming initiative, making the capital a focal point for interactive entertainment. Third, destination and live entertainment, Yas Island’s parks, arenas, and event calendar, from Formula 1 to global concerts, anchor a visitor-economy model.
Layered over this is a fast-moving consumption shift: high streaming penetration, strong appetite for Arabic-language originals, and a creator economy shaping what younger audiences discover.

Gaming Preferences in the Arabic Region
Challenge: A global gaming company sought to localize its offerings for Arabic-speaking players. Adoption was strong, but the client lacked clarity on genre preferences, the value of Arabic dubbing, and whether local-accent voiceovers strengthened or disrupted immersion.
Approach: Sapience designed a multi-method framework:
- Quantitative Surveys: mapped genre preferences, platform usage, and play frequency.
- Qualitative Interviews: explored emotional responses to Arabic dubbing and tone.
- Demographic Segmentation: identified player clusters by age, gender, and nationality.
- Language Sentiment Mapping: assessed reactions to dialect variation and accent use.
Outcome: Sports and action dominated among male players while simulation and fantasy skewed female; demand for Arabic dubbing in high-production titles was strong; and local accents suited some genres but not others. The client gained a prioritized localization roadmap.
